Ingredients & Little Kitchen Secrets
Here’s what I use:
- 1 sheet puff pastry (thawed)
- 1 cup grated cheese (cheddar, parmesan, or a mix)
- 1 egg (for egg wash)
- 1 tablespoon milk
- 1 teaspoon dried oregano or thyme
- A pinch of black pepper
My secret? I don’t overload the pastry. I add just enough cheese so it melts without making everything too heavy.
And I always press the cheese gently into the dough so it stays in place when I twist.
How I Make It, Step by Step
- I preheat my oven to 200°C.
- I roll out the puff pastry slightly on a clean surface.
- I sprinkle the cheese evenly over the dough.
- I add herbs and a little pepper.
- I gently press everything into the pastry.
- I cut the pastry into long strips.
- I twist each strip carefully with my hands.
- I place them on a baking tray lined with paper.
- I mix the egg with milk and brush each twist.
- I bake for 15–20 minutes until golden and crispy.
When I see that golden color, I know they’re ready.

Storage, Reheating & Make-Ahead Tips
If I have leftovers (which is rare), I store them in an airtight container for up to 2 days.
To reheat, I always use the oven. It brings back the crispiness.
You can also prepare the twists ahead and bake them fresh when needed.
